在一个两位数的两个数字中间插入一个一个数(包括0),变成一个三位数。例如,在72的7与2之间插入6,成为762。

来源:百度知道 编辑:UC知道 时间:2024/06/17 03:47:59
这样形成的三位数有些是原来两位数的9倍,这样的两位数有几个?分别是多少?
要过程

Private Sub Command1_Click()
Dim s As String, ss As String
For i = 10 To 99
s = Trim(Str(i))
For j = 0 To 9
ss = Trim(Str(j))
If CInt(Left(s, 1) & ss & Right(s, 1)) = i * 9 Then Print i, j
Next j
Next i
End Sub

15-135
25-225
35-315
45-405

因为这样的数个位只可能是 5

Private Sub Command1_Click()
Dim i As Integer
Dim j As Integer

For i = 15 To 95 Step 5
For j = 0 To 9
If (i \ 10) * 100 + j * 10 + (i Mod 10) = i * 9 Then
Print i, j
End If
Next j
Next i

End Sub

在一个两位数的两个数字中间插入一个数(包括0),变成一个三位数, 一个两位数中间加一个数字,这两位数变成三位,且该三位数是原来两位数的九倍,这样的两位数有几个? 一个两位数,在它的两个数中间添一个0,就比原来的数多630,这样的两位数共有几个? 在一个两位数的两个数之间插入一个0,所得的三位数比原来的数大8倍.求这个两位数. 一个两位数,在它的两个数字之间添上一个0,它就比原来的数多630,这样的两位数一共有多少个? 一个两位数在它的两个数字之间添上一个0,就比原来的数多450,这样的两位数共有多少个 一个两位数,个位上的数字是十位上的数字的2倍,先将这个两位数的两个数字对调,得到第二个两位数 一个两位数,在两个数字间添一个“0”,它就比原来多630,这种两位数共有多少个?最大的是多少? 一个两位数,十位数字比个位数字大5,且这两位数比两个数位上数字之和的8倍还大5,求这个两位数 两个整数相加时,得到的数是一个两位数,且两个数字相同相乘时,